"""
Unit tests for BotService.
Tests bot CRUD operations with mocked persistence and runtime managers.
Source: src/langbot/pkg/api/http/service/bot.py
"""
from __future__ import annotations
import pytest
from unittest.mock import AsyncMock, Mock, patch
from types import SimpleNamespace
import uuid
from langbot.pkg.api.http.service.bot import BotService
from langbot.pkg.entity.persistence.bot import Bot
pytestmark = pytest.mark.asyncio
def _create_mock_bot(
bot_uuid: str = None,
name: str = 'Test Bot',
description: str = 'Test Description',
adapter: str = 'telegram',
adapter_config: dict = None,
enable: bool = True,
use_pipeline_uuid: str = None,
use_pipeline_name: str = None,
) -> Mock:
"""Helper to create mock Bot entity."""
bot = Mock(spec=Bot)
bot.uuid = bot_uuid or str(uuid.uuid4())
bot.name = name
bot.description = description
bot.adapter = adapter
bot.adapter_config = adapter_config or {'token': 'test_token'}
bot.enable = enable
bot.use_pipeline_uuid = use_pipeline_uuid
bot.use_pipeline_name = use_pipeline_name
bot.pipeline_routing_rules = []
return bot
def _create_mock_result(items: list = None, first_item=None):
"""Create mock result object for persistence queries."""
result = Mock()
result.all = Mock(return_value=items or [])
result.first = Mock(return_value=first_item)
return result
class TestBotServiceGetBots:
"""Tests for get_bots method."""
async def test_get_bots_empty_list(self):
"""Returns empty list when no bots exist."""
# Setup
ap = SimpleNamespace()
ap.persistence_mgr = SimpleNamespace()
mock_result = _create_mock_result([])
ap.persistence_mgr.execute_async = AsyncMock(return_value=mock_result)
ap.persistence_mgr.serialize_model = Mock(
side_effect=lambda model_cls, entity, masked_columns=None: {
'uuid': entity.uuid,
'name': entity.name,
'adapter': entity.adapter,
}
)
service = BotService(ap)
# Execute
result = await service.get_bots()
# Verify
assert result == []
async def test_get_bots_returns_list_with_secrets(self):
"""Returns bot list including adapter_config by default."""
# Setup
ap = SimpleNamespace()
ap.persistence_mgr = SimpleNamespace()
bot1 = _create_mock_bot(bot_uuid='uuid-1', name='Bot 1')
bot2 = _create_mock_bot(bot_uuid='uuid-2', name='Bot 2')
mock_result = _create_mock_result([bot1, bot2])
ap.persistence_mgr.execute_async = AsyncMock(return_value=mock_result)
ap.persistence_mgr.serialize_model = Mock(
side_effect=lambda model_cls, entity, masked_columns=None: {
'uuid': entity.uuid,
'name': entity.name,
'adapter': entity.adapter,
'adapter_config': entity.adapter_config if 'adapter_config' not in (masked_columns or []) else None,
}
)
service = BotService(ap)
# Execute
result = await service.get_bots(include_secret=True)
# Verify
assert len(result) == 2
assert result[0]['name'] == 'Bot 1'
assert result[0]['adapter_config'] is not None
async def test_get_bots_masks_secrets(self):
"""Returns bot list without adapter_config when include_secret=False."""
# Setup
ap = SimpleNamespace()
ap.persistence_mgr = SimpleNamespace()
bot1 = _create_mock_bot(bot_uuid='uuid-1', name='Bot 1')
mock_result = _create_mock_result([bot1])
ap.persistence_mgr.execute_async = AsyncMock(return_value=mock_result)
ap.persistence_mgr.serialize_model = Mock(
side_effect=lambda model_cls, entity, masked_columns=None: {
'uuid': entity.uuid,
'name': entity.name,
'adapter': entity.adapter,
'adapter_config': entity.adapter_config if 'adapter_config' not in (masked_columns or []) else None,
}
)
service = BotService(ap)
# Execute
result = await service.get_bots(include_secret=False)
# Verify - adapter_config should be masked
assert result[0]['adapter_config'] is None
